Each year Opera Australia presents a series of fundraising events in Sydney and Melbourne aimed at raising essential funds to support the performers and creative teams that bring the magic of opera to life. Opera Australia's fundraising events include opera galas in Sydney and Melbourne, an online auction, backstage tours, fine wines, gourmet menus, intimate dinners and exclusive opera performances.
